Planning in fixed time intervals - resource cycle

Planning takes place in fixed time frames. All work steps within a time frame have identical start and end dates. This creates freedom of action for processing. An order / project usually runs through many time frames, depending on the complexity of the added value. Compliance with WIP limits, i.e. limiting the worklist to what is feasible, through capacity-checked planning. This regulates the stock level and therefore also the flow rate. Planning in time grids, taking into account all capacity limits, creates the necessary room for maneuver at the operational level.


Coarsening of the planning

As coarse as possible, only as fine as necessary! By forming resource groups, teams and machine groups, planning can be coarsened as required. This leads to a very efficient determination of delivery dates with great robustness and, on the other hand, creates the absolutely necessary room for maneuver for execution. It must be possible to react flexibly and independently to disruptions, deviations, etc. This creates acceptance and is the key to high adherence to delivery dates.


Flexible capacity model

Use flexibility, do not commit to nonsensical dates!

Unlike traditional planning systems, our innovative planning approach makes it possible to fill the cycles against flexible capacity limits. The PiT® traffic light model already takes into account the degree of flexibility possible in the company when simulating orders. As a result, it is already clear at the rough planning stage whether overtime, additional shifts or other flexibility measures need to be introduced in order to achieve the highest possible delivery capacity.

The visualization of the traffic light status creates the necessary transparency for everyone to initiate appropriate measures in advance. This creates acceptance, reduces disruptions and brings calm to the execution level.


Separation of draft and detailed planning

The central draft planning allows orders or complex projects to be scheduled quickly and with little effort at the click of a mouse. This means that all key dates are set. The cycles are filled via the rough planning. Processing within the cycles is decentralized at the execution level. This is where it is determined within the cycle who carries out which task and when, or on which machine an order is executed. This has the advantage that detailed planning can be carried out decoupled for each area, depending on set-up restrictions, sequence criteria, faults, etc., without jeopardizing the order throughput as a whole.

PiT® in production

The cycle creates a worklist with room for maneuver for the execution level. Detailed planning is decentralized there. The resource cycle fulfills two tasks: To create leeway for optimization, sequencing, reaction to disruptions as well as bindingness in execution and robustness of planning.

PiT® in projects

The tasks usually run over several cycles. Multi-project planning is online and capacity-checked. The task of the cycle is to coarsen the key dates, reduce multitasking and provide intelligent buffer management.
